Geographical relief significantly impacts climate by influencing temperature, precipitation, and wind patterns. Areas near mountains often experience orographic lift, where moist air is forced to rise, leading to increased precipitation on the windward side and dry conditions on the leeward side, known as rain shadows. Proximity to oceans moderates temperatures, resulting in milder climates with less temperature variation, while coastal areas often receive more rainfall due to the moisture from the ocean. Additionally, ocean currents can influence local climates by transporting warm or cold water, further affecting weather patterns.

Who are some early settlers in the rocky mountain region?
Early settlers in the Rocky Mountain region included fur trappers and traders such as Jim Bridger and John Colter, who explored and mapped the area in the early 19th century. The Mormons, led by Brigham Young, established a significant settlement in Salt Lake Valley in 1847. Additionally, gold rushes in the mid-1800s attracted many prospectors and miners, leading to the establishment of towns like Denver and Colorado Springs. These settlers contributed to the region's development and the expansion of the United States westward.

What rain shadow is created by Sierra Nevada?
The Sierra Nevada mountain range creates a rain shadow effect primarily affecting the eastern side of the range. As moist air from the Pacific Ocean rises over the mountains, it cools and condenses, leading to precipitation on the western slopes. Consequently, the eastern slopes, including areas like the Great Basin, receive significantly less rainfall, resulting in arid conditions and desert-like environments. This contrast highlights the impact of topography on regional climate patterns.
What would cause a balloon to expand it take him to the top of a mountain?
As a balloon ascends to the top of a mountain, the decrease in atmospheric pressure causes the air inside the balloon to expand. According to Boyle's Law, when the external pressure decreases, the volume of a gas increases if the temperature remains constant. This expansion can potentially lead to the balloon bursting if it exceeds the material's limits. Additionally, temperature changes with altitude may also affect the balloon's behavior.
